When Esperanza is a young girl learning with difficulty to crochet, her grandmother unravels all of her rows and advises, "Do not be afraid to start over." Although Esperanza does not realize it at the time, this advice will become her guiding principle as she learns to confront some of life's harsher realities. Politicians spout their opinions every day on what to do about the number of undocumented immigrants living in the U.S. We're talking everything from an electrified fence that would keep illegal immigrants out of the U.S. to the DREAM Act, a law that would make it easier for children of undocumented immigrants to become citizens. As Esperanza grows older, she has come to understand that a "river" separates her from her servantseven her friend, playmate, and crush, the sixteen-year-old Miguel, who works alongside his father Alfonso on Esperanza's wealthy father Sixto 's ranch. So go Esperanzas Abuelitas crocheting lessons, symbolic sessions in which Abuelita attempts to impress upon Esperanza, the importance of seeing that life is a series of peaks and valleys rather than a straight line.
